The Founders Kept Abortion Legal: A History of Abortion in America
Guest: Geoffrey R. Stone is the Edward H. Levi Distinguished Service Professor at the University of Chicago. In 1973 he was a law clerk to Supreme Court Justice William J. Brennan when the Roe v. Wade decision was released. He is the author of the book Sex and the Constitution: Sex, Religion and Law from America’s Origins to the Twenty-First Century. His forthcoming book is called Social Media, Freedom of Speech, and the Future of our Democracy.
